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 284064 37627771 23808 249289550
24211582 79977
24211582 79977
643933 33008 49337807 5810653305
All about undefined
Interested in learning more?
24211582 79977
643933 33008 49337807 5810653305
See more
60272427 59166855597 78
005661 358 784
See more
76585537 304933557
48537476 82553053 19 506685806 88443
See more